    Associates a customer gateway with a device and optionally, with a link. If you specify a link, it must be associated with the specified device.

    Example Usage

    using System.Collections.Generic;
    using System.Linq;
    using Pulumi;
    using Aws = Pulumi.Aws;
    
    return await Deployment.RunAsync(() => 
    {
        var exampleGlobalNetwork = new Aws.NetworkManager.GlobalNetwork("exampleGlobalNetwork", new()
        {
            Description = "example",
        });
    
        var exampleSite = new Aws.NetworkManager.Site("exampleSite", new()
        {
            GlobalNetworkId = exampleGlobalNetwork.Id,
        });
    
        var exampleDevice = new Aws.NetworkManager.Device("exampleDevice", new()
        {
            GlobalNetworkId = exampleGlobalNetwork.Id,
            SiteId = exampleSite.Id,
        });
    
        var exampleCustomerGateway = new Aws.Ec2.CustomerGateway("exampleCustomerGateway", new()
        {
            BgpAsn = "65000",
            IpAddress = "172.83.124.10",
            Type = "ipsec.1",
        });
    
        var exampleTransitGateway = new Aws.Ec2TransitGateway.TransitGateway("exampleTransitGateway");
    
        var exampleVpnConnection = new Aws.Ec2.VpnConnection("exampleVpnConnection", new()
        {
            CustomerGatewayId = exampleCustomerGateway.Id,
            TransitGatewayId = exampleTransitGateway.Id,
            Type = exampleCustomerGateway.Type,
            StaticRoutesOnly = true,
        });
    
        var exampleTransitGatewayRegistration = new Aws.NetworkManager.TransitGatewayRegistration("exampleTransitGatewayRegistration", new()
        {
            GlobalNetworkId = exampleGlobalNetwork.Id,
            TransitGatewayArn = exampleTransitGateway.Arn,
        }, new CustomResourceOptions
        {
            DependsOn = new[]
            {
                exampleVpnConnection,
            },
        });
    
        var exampleCustomerGatewayAssociation = new Aws.NetworkManager.CustomerGatewayAssociation("exampleCustomerGatewayAssociation", new()
        {
            GlobalNetworkId = exampleGlobalNetwork.Id,
            CustomerGatewayArn = exampleCustomerGateway.Arn,
            DeviceId = exampleDevice.Id,
        }, new CustomResourceOptions
        {
            DependsOn = new[]
            {
                exampleTransitGatewayRegistration,
            },
        });
    
    });

    Inputs

    The CustomerGatewayAssociation resource accepts the following input properties:

    CustomerGatewayArn string

    The Amazon Resource Name (ARN) of the customer gateway.

    DeviceId string

    The ID of the device.

    GlobalNetworkId string

    The ID of the global network.

    LinkId string

    The ID of the link.

    Import

    Using pulumi import, import aws_networkmanager_customer_gateway_association using the global network ID and customer gateway ARN. For example:

     $ pulumi import aws:networkmanager/customerGatewayAssociation:CustomerGatewayAssociation example global-network-0d47f6t230mz46dy4,arn:aws:ec2:us-west-2:123456789012:customer-gateway/cgw-123abc05e04123abc
